Output 8e6fd1d53756db09b983ad718e748e7a659b9c51822e6a0dd53babf5dd13f743:0

value
11975689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f577f1bdb84840a7490bf8559758841c57cf9322 OP_EQUAL
address
3Q4wARDbKUXCSsxq9XBh47uxoyM24eZWEZ
transaction
8e6fd1d53756db09b983ad718e748e7a659b9c51822e6a0dd53babf5dd13f743
confirmations
238546
spent
true